Burrows, George
Biography
George H. Burrows was active in Cleveland after 1922. He graduated from the University of Michigan School of Architecture in 1920. He worked for Asa Hudson, Griebel & Eberling; Clark, McMullen and Riley; and Alfred Harris. He was a partner in the firm of Brooke and Burrows 1925-6. He belonged to the University Club, the American Institute of Architects, and the Ohio Society of Architects. He designed nearly one thousand homes in Shaker Heights, Cleveland Heights, and other eastern suburbs. He designed a number of apartment buildings in the Shaker Square neighborhood and along Van Aken Boulevard. See also Brooke & Burrows
